Homemade Chinese Five Spice Powder

Homemade Chinese Five Spice Powder - one of my favorite spice blends. Sichuan peppercorns, star anise, cloves, fennel, and cinnamon combine to create a wonderful and uniquely flavored seasoning.

Dry-Fried Sichuan Beans

These dry-fried Sichuan beans are intensely flavorful.

"What is dry stir-frying?" you ask. It's a technique (gon chau) that intensifies flavors by slightly charring ingredients over lower heat over a longer period of time.
